Application class loader should not see server classes
------------------------------------------------------
Key: GERONIMO-1772
URL: http://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/GERONIMO-1772
Project: Geronimo
Type: Improvement
Components: core, deployment, kernel
Versions: 1.0
Reporter: Aaron Mulder
Fix For: 1.1, 1.2
By default, applications should have a parent class loader that just has the spec JARs -- not Spring, commons logging, Geronimo code, etc.
